**14:32** — User module split from the Corvalle monolith completed. New `corvalle-identity` service took over auth traffic. Plugin authors: legacy `/users` endpoints now proxy with a 90-day sunset. Root cause of the earlier 502s was a stale service-mesh route cached by the Delvin gateway; flushed at 14:40. Verify your plugins against the new service before the proxy retires. The deployment's trace token is recorded below.

session token of tajef-bageg = htk21_5d90d574934f3ccae6437

Subject: Partner SFTP drop — new owner

Hi,

As you review the pending changes to the Harborline ingest scripts, note that ownership of the partner SFTP drop is changing at the end of the month. This includes key rotation, the nightly pull job, and the quarantine folder for malformed files. Review comments on the retry logic should still go through the normal PR flow, but questions about drop-folder conventions or partner onboarding now go to the new owner. The incoming owner is listed below.

signatory, tagaf-bahaf: Praael Fenmir Rusok

Handover: Payment retry idempotency — Marta to Deniz

Short version for support: every payment retry on Coinward reuses the idempotency key from the first attempt, so customers are never double-charged even if they click retry repeatedly. Keys expire after the retention window; retries after that are treated as new payments. If a customer reports a duplicate charge, check whether the two attempts share a key before escalating. No open incidents. The current retry and key-retention settings are as follows.

deployment values, yadup-kadug:
[sorys]
port = 5672
team = noveth
host = sorys.orvexcorp.example
region = south-4
access_code = ac_deddc1
timeout_ms = 1500

Hi, and welcome to on-call. Before Thursday's sync, please read up on the Glidepath migration. We are retiring the cron jobs on the Westmarch scheduler host in three phases: read-only mirroring, dual execution with cron authoritative, then Glidepath authoritative. We're currently in phase two, which means alerts can fire from either system. Always check the Glidepath run history first, since it has richer failure context. Phase status, job ownership, and rollback steps are tracked on the internal page below.

dashboard of tahop-fahof = https://harbor.tolvaqnet.example/secrets/merge_requests/board/issue/merge_requests/pipeline/secrets/ecb30ed86a55c001a77f6cb9